I'm trying to suppress alerts from 2 machines where this traffic is normal. When using base to identify the SID it says the SID is 151 but when I search snort.org I can not find THIS rule. I have searched high and low to find references to this specific instance of the rule (I have already suppressed SID 527). I have run grep in my rules directory to find the rule that is creating this alert to no avail. the forum has no entries on this nor can I find anything in the archives. Where is this alert being generated from? Any help is greatly appreciated Mike
